Guest guest Posted November 21, 2008 Report Share Posted November 21, 2008 I spoke to Dr Hoffman today and he was incredibly nice and gave me some useful info I really wanted to share. He said my symptoms of debilitating aching, back stiffness, headaches, joint issues can be due to many reasons and some of them over-lapping; 1) LDN is causing an increase of symptoms for the Crohn's that is being expressed by Extra Intestinal Manifestations such as joint issues etc (the above mentioned) 2) The Erlichiosis might be going out of whack and it is in fact a Lyme Co-infection issue. 3) Vitamin D and Vitamin D3 deficiency 4) He does not think that my transdermal cream from Hopewell is bad but he said in order to ease my concern he will place an order with Coastal. Game plan: LDN is doing well on gut issues so he thinks I should increase LDN to 3 and see if it also helps with body issues. Take liquid vitamin D3 (between 5000-6000 units daily) See where we go from there. He think me starting therapy for Erlichiosis is not a bad idea although he wants me to do it under GI's instruction since I need to do various C Diff testing and C Diff carrier testing too.
